Protected Land

The Georgia Piedmont Land Trust has approximately 36 properties totaling 870 acres under permanent protection.

While most of our properties are in Gwinnett County our service area has expanded with the addition of properties in Dekalb, Hall, Walton and Rockdale counties.

Our protected properties include:

  • Sweetwater Creek
  • Baker's Rock

  • Drowning Creek
  • Calloway-Garner Cemetery

  • Yellow River Wetlands
  • Candler Park Community Garden (Dekalb)
  • Belton Stream Corridor (Hall)
  • Monestary of the Holy Spirit Green Cemetary (Rockdale)
